THE STORY


From digital transformation to human transition.

For more than two decades, I worked at the forefront of digital transformation — building businesses, leading teams and navigating change across agencies, consultancies and global organisations, including Sapient, Pixelpark, Accenture and AKQA. What began as a fascination with technology and new possibilities gradually became a deeper inquiry into people. Because underneath every strategy, every transformation and every new way of working, I kept encountering the same thing: change is ultimately human. It is shaped by how we relate to uncertainty, identity, power, one another — and to ourselves. In 2015, I founded SOULWORX to make this human dimension the centre of the work. Since then, my practice has expanded from leadership and organisational transformation into personal transition, midlife, writing and spaces for inquiry and connection. The contexts are different. The underlying question remains remarkably similar: How do we stay connected to what matters when the old form no longer fits and the new one has not yet fully emerged?

The first 20 years were digital. The next 20 are human.

FOUNDER | Julia von Winterfeldt

I have always been interested in what makes us come alive — and what gets in the way.

My work has taken me through boardrooms, transformation programmes, leadership teams, coaching rooms, circles and retreats. Different contexts, but often the same underlying question: What becomes possible when we stop performing what is expected and reconnect with what is true? Today, I bring together more than two decades of business and leadership experience with systemic coaching, therapeutic practice, embodiment and trauma-informed work.
